This is Gherasim Luca’s "Transpercer la transparence (1)," and, well, it's hard to say when it was made or with what! The way those pale shapes overlap, like trying to catch smoke. They're like thoughts layered on thoughts, each one slightly obscuring the one beneath. It reminds me that artmaking is often about revealing and concealing at the same time, about the push and pull of showing and hiding. The texture here, or lack of it, is telling. You've got these thin, translucent layers that build up a subtle depth. Look how the light filters through the whole image. This reminds me of Agnes Martin, she aimed at this lightness, but in such a different way, and I'm taken by the idea of art as an ongoing conversation, these artists reaching across time. It's a reminder that art doesn't always need to shout; sometimes, the quietest voices resonate the loudest.
